In Oilton, common Subaru issues include head gasket leaks, especially in older models like the Outback and Forester, and CV joint wear from driving on rural gravel and dirt roads. The local climate also makes battery and electrical system checks important due to temperature extremes.
Look for shops in Oilton or nearby towns like Drumright or Cushing that specifically advertise Subaru expertise or Japanese auto repair. Check for ASE-certified technicians and read local reviews or ask for recommendations at local businesses, as trustworthy mechanics are valued in our small community.
Labor rates in Oilton are often lower than in Tulsa or Oklahoma City, but parts for Subarus may need to be ordered, which can add time. Overall, you may save on labor, but it's wise to get a written estimate that includes parts sourcing and labor.
Seek service if you notice unusual noises or vibrations, especially after navigating muddy or uneven terrain common in Oilton's rural areas. Regular maintenance of the AWD system is crucial for safety on our county roads and during seasonal weather changes.
The dusty, unpaved roads around Oilton mean air filters and cabin air filters need more frequent changes. Also, preparing your Subaru's cooling system for hot Oklahoma summers and checking undercarriage components for rust or damage from rough terrain is essential.
